Floyd, Virginia, in Floyd county, is 32 miles SW of Roanoke, Virginia (center to center) and 120 miles N of Charlotte, North Carolina. The town has a population of 432.
In Floyd, about 46% of adults are married.
In 2000, Floyd had a median family income of $40,938.
In the 2004 Presidential fund-raising sweepstakes, John Kerry came out ahead among Floyd residents, with $6,250. Residents gave more to the Democratic party than any of the others.
In Floyd, 52% of the houses and apartments are occupied by the owners, not rented out.
In Floyd, 92% of commuters drive to work.
